I feel like the FPS genre in general was doomed from the start, especially as the people who were originally passionate about their games moved on or are replaced by corporatards who shove out annual copy+paste releases which shifts focus from gameplay perfection to money generation. Halo freshened things up quite, both for PvP and single-player but the modern audience demands newer and faster shooters which is why newer Halo's sucked so much as it doesn't work well in fast paced gameplay. It "killed" boomer shooters simply because the gameplay of those games had run its course. It was new but still familiar and was simply the result of the natural evolution of this genre which was already advancing away from boomer shooters anyways. That video raises all the right reasons on why Halo's gameplay worked out so well in its time. It's just now nobody in the industry can successfully replicate it nor can anyone make something actually revolutionary.

In the current drought, you last long enough in this genre to typically end up back where you were, hence the Doom remakes + CoD and Battlefield looking identical nowadays. FPS's are doomed to 5v5 shooters or 50v50 slogs with single-player not even being an option most of the time if other games don't evolve themselves and advance the genre like Halo and its contemporaries did. If not, enjoy WW2 era shooter 456, generic hero shooter 11 and the same CoD game released for the 10th time. But of course, you can only go so far in this genre before reinventing the wheel anyways and that's why it's doomed to begin with.

Vergil wrote: May 31st, 2024, 06:22
A common topic that I see online is that there was a golden age of FPS games before Halo came along and consolized the genre throwing it into a massive slump until the relatively recent arrival of throw back shooters like the newer Doom games and indies. Personally I highly disagree with this view point and think that if anything Halo did something unique and interesting with what was a pretty stale genre. Most games that tried to copy Halo failed to understand what made it good and a lot of the things detractors have to say about Halo itself make it sound like they've never played it themselves. There's a pretty good video on this that made me curious to get the RPGHQ take on this topic since there seems to be a good mix of geriatrics and zoomers here. :eyebrows:
Generally speaking, Boomer Shooters are very linear, and almost exclusively Single Player.

Halo, I feel was almost more of a tech demo when they made it, given its scope; but regardless, it set a new standard for what the genre could achieve -- and I do earnestly believe it allowed things like COD to become as powerful as it has.

I don't however, think that Halo killed it directly, since the Shooter genre had begun to move away from that anyway -- with things like Timesplitters, Red Faction, and Army Men (where my boomers at?) coming out at the same sort of time. I feel there was a new zeitgeist in gaming; newer technology allowed for more interesting systems, allowing for broader scope in gaming.

As for the consolisation... Arguably that is simply tied to gaming becoming a more 'marketable' medium. As much as I don't think it really matters, it is still true, PC gaming has always been a niche in regards to markets. It was an inevitability that console gaming would take off for the mass market. The important part is that consoles and large player lobby gaming meant that there was no reason to stick to the traditional style of shooter, as it didn't really utilise the consoles (at the time, they were not necessarily too far behind PCs) decent tech.
